Nayifat Finance Approves SAR 744,572 Board Remuneration
NAYIFAT 4081.SA | 0.00 |
Nayifat Finance Co. announced on June 4, 2026 the results of its Ordinary General Assembly Meeting held on June 3, 2026 at the company's Riyadh headquarters via the Tadawulaty system, with 50.29% shareholder attendance. The assembly approved multiple resolutions including SAR 744,572 in remuneration for Board of Directors and committee members for fiscal year 2025, appointment of Ernst & Young Professional Services as external auditor for specified periods in 2026-2027 with fees of SAR 1,285,000, and amendments to various corporate governance regulations and committee charters. Additionally, shareholders approved related party transactions with Yaqeen Capital involving commodity agency services (SAR 505,000 in 2025) and treasury share management services (SAR 73,000 in management fees plus SAR 43.374 million for share purchases in 2025), where board members have indirect interests.
